 For sale is a 1974 Candy Riviera Blue K3 Honda CT70 CT 70 Mini Trail 70. This bike is sold with no title despite what the drop down menu made me select. The frame Vin is CT70-2320299 and the motor Vin is CT70E-2317341. The manufacture date of the frame is 1/74.  This bike does start within the first couple kicks and drives very nicely as it should. The bike is probably due for a "tune up kit" along with a good carburetor cleaning from sitting, age of the bike, and current mileage of 3,211. The bike overall is in decent condition with about 40 years worth of normal wear and tear. The chrome does have some pitting and rusting. The paint is original also with 40 years of wear and tear. The exhaust was poorly repaired by the previous owner. The exhaust still leaks and is louder than normal. The seat has been recovered and pan had been welded. The handlebars are free at the knobs and will still fold down. I have tried to explain the bike to the best of my ability and represent the bike the best if could with the photos I have provided. NEW: Yoshimura ends cans for Honda CB1000R

Wed, 10 Feb 2010

LEGENDARY JAPANESE tuning house Yoshimura has designed a series of slip-on performance end cans for Honda’s naked CB1000R.The brand new EEC-approved cans bolt straight onto the bike's exiting pipework and feature a stainless steel end cone and integral lower Yoshimura logoed cat-converter heat shield. Even with the dB-Killer baffle in place peak power is improved, as is mid-range torque with further performance gains available if the baffle is removed.A full race mid-pipe, extracting yet more power is on the way and will be available later in the year.
